BOXING.
HARRY LISTER’S' GAMINESS.
HIS MATCH WITH RODERICK. (Received This Day, 10.10 a.m.) LONDON, November 1. Ernie Roderick, who defeated Harry Lister on points in a 10-round bout yesterday, is probably the best welterweight in England. He is much cleverer than Lister, whose grit was applauded. The “Daily Dispatch,” remarking that Lister is probably not acclimatised, said that Roderick had Lister beaten in everything except gameness.
